4,294,973,034 is a composite number, even.
4,294,973,034 (four billion two hundred ninety-four million nine hundred seventy-three thousand thirty-four) is an even 10-digit number. It is a composite number with 96 divisors, and factors as 2 × 3² × 11 × 23 × 61 × 15,461. Its proper divisors sum to 6,472,516,374,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x10000166A.
